Workers' settlement, likewise understood as "workers' compensation," offers advantages to employees that come to be injured or ill on the work due to a job-related crash. Workers' payment is a state government-mandated program, however the required advantages differ from state to state.
Federal workers' payment programs additionally exist, covering federal and power employees, as well as longshore and nurture employees. Companies can not call for workers to pay for the expense of employees' compensation.
Nevertheless, some workers get made up for longer durations if they suffer some sort of long-term handicap, whether partial or full handicap. Employees' settlement advantages are not typically taxed at the state or government level, making up for much of the lost earnings. However, you may pay taxes on your workers' compensation advantages if you additionally obtain revenue from the Social Safety And Security Disability or Supplemental Safety And Security Revenue programs.

A company may dispute an employees' payment claim considering that disputes can develop over whether the company is accountable for an injury or ailment.
Workers' payment settlements are vulnerable to insurance fraud. An employee might falsely report that their injury was suffered at work, exaggerate the intensity of an injury, or develop an injury. The National Insurance policy Criminal activity Board insists that there are "organized criminal conspiracies of jagged doctors, lawyers, and individuals" who send false claims to clinical insurance companies for workers' settlement and various other benefits.

Normally, just staff members are qualified for workers' settlement; service providers and consultants are not. Past that, every state writes its very own rules. As an example, Arkansas especially excludes ranch workers and realty agents from eligibility.
Louisiana leaves out musicians and crop-dusting airplane crew members. Every state (other than Texas) calls for employers to supply employees' settlement coverage to at least several of their staff members. The states write the regulations, so there are several exemptions and exemptions. Specialists and consultants are hardly ever covered, and many states omit particular professions from the mandate or otherwise restrict the extent of the benefits.

Workers' settlement also covers employees that remain in a collision while driving a firm car. It is essential to keep in mind that workers' payment is a no-fault system. This suggests that a worker that might be at mistake for creating a mishap will certainly still have the ability to recuperate advantages under the Illinois Workers' Payment Act.
Workers that are devoting a criminal act at the time of the automobile accident will certainly not have the ability to safeguard advantages. An employer's employees' payment carrier will likely reject coverage for prices connected with injuries endured in an accident while dedicating a criminal activity. An additional exception to insurance coverage exists for staff members who are travelling to work but have actually not yet started functioning.
